Regarding the recruitment of other Guardians to take part in the HARD Atheon Raid, I feel like people should stop asking for ONLY Level 30 Guardians to take part. The reason is because it's completely unfair and unjustified.
Let me just say I have nothing against Level 30 Guardians, quite the opposite I admire that they were able to grind and play long enough to attain the necessary Gear to excel to we're are right now. What I don't like is going to Several clan forums and discovering those who's requirements to join there raid is to be Lvl 30.
There is absolutely nothing wrong with having Lvl 30's in your Fireteam, but turning someone down who is level 29 with an Abundance of Raid Experience is just stupid. Especially if said person is a Sunsinger with the potential to resurrect other players. Level 29 and level 30 players are not drastically far from each other. What matters in a raid Foremost is experience. Nobody likes to teach and raid at the same time and if you do I applaud you truly. I have had completed raids in an Hour with a mix of 26 to 28 characters who have plenty of experience and are just Raiding another character.
I have also done the Hard raid within two hours with a group of all level 29 and we're fine because everyone knew what they were doing.
This post is not to bash level 30's, all I'm saying is give us level 29's a chance. Who knows, this may be the raid that gives us that armor piece we need and take us to Level 30.
